Four Aspens
Lens: Pentax DA* 200mm f2.8 Camera: Pentax K-1 Photo Location: Mono Lake area ISO: 100 Shutter Speed: 3s Aperture: F18 
Posted By: Denali_Mark, 01-02-2017, 11:04 AM

This October I was fortunate t participate in a workshop with John Sexton, Charles Cramer, and Anne Larsen at Mono Lakes. One of the highlights of the trip was to capture the fall colors of the aspen groves along June Lake Road just south of the community of Lee Vining
